Seamless Intelligence: Google Launches Gemini Integration in Chrome for Indian Users with 50+ Language Support

In a major step toward democratizing advanced artificial intelligence, Google has officially rolled out Gemini integration directly within the Chrome browser for the Indian market, offering a powerful, built-in chat experience that supports over 50 languages. This strategic launch allows users to interact with Google’s most capable AI model without leaving their active tabs, enabling real-time assistance for tasks such as summarizing complex articles, drafting emails, and generating creative content. By prioritizing the Indian demographic, Google has ensured that the integration is deeply localized, catering to the country’s diverse linguistic landscape by supporting major regional languages alongside English. This move is seen as a direct effort to make AI more accessible and intuitive for millions of students, professionals, and casual web surfers who rely on Chrome as their primary window to the internet.

The browser-based integration is designed to be lightweight yet transformative, featuring a dedicated side panel that allows for a fluid “multimodal” workflow where users can prompt the AI based on the specific webpage they are currently viewing. Beyond mere text generation, Gemini in Chrome is equipped to handle complex queries, provide coding assistance, and even translate content on the fly, making it an indispensable tool for productivity in an increasingly digital economy.
